Ghostscript is free, and not in the least bit printer specific. You will need to scroll down to the Microsoft Windows section and also don't forget to download Ghost view as well. It is the actual interface that allows you to do your thing. Ghostscript itself merely runs in the background. If you don't know about it, what Ghostscript does for us, is allow us to install another Postscript driver, which essentially fools our programs like CorelDRAW and Illustrator and Photoshop into making halftone manipulation active (rather than defaulting to our none-postscript printer specs.
